    ME PRO 2014.

    How to change the font type and size of the labels in ME?

    The MyEclipse menu label fonts are controlled by your OS. Please change the system font to change the MyEclipse menu font.

    To change the font in the editors, please go to Window > Preferences > General > Appearance > Colors and Fonts. For example you can change the text font in the text editors by editing the Basic > Text Font.
